About this home

This well-maintained 4-bedroom, 2.5-bath is less than a mile from the heart of downtown Weaverville. The neighborhood features city-maintained streets and sidewalks with easy access to local shops, restaurants, cafés, and breweries, and mountain views from the end of the cul-de-sac. The main level features a comfortable living room, dining area, and a bright kitchen with stainless steel appliances. Also on the main floor are the primary suite overlooking the backyard and an additional bedroom that works well as a guest room, office, or flex space. Upstairs are two more bedrooms, a shared bathroom, and a convenient laundry closet. Outdoor living is easy with a covered front porch and a back deck overlooking the fenced yard—ideal for pets, gardening, or relaxing. With a sensibly sized yard, low-maintenance upkeep, and convenient access to I-26 and downtown Asheville (less than 15 minutes away), this home offers the perfect blend of comfort, convenience, and lifestyle.
